What is a business process according to the provided text?
A completely closed, timely and logical sequence of activities required to work on a business object
What is a model in the context of business process modeling?
A simplifying mapping of reality to serve a specific purpose
What does business process modeling aim to represent?
Business activities, information flow, and decision logic
What is the purpose of visualization in business process modeling?
To communicate information regarding a process and its interactions within/between organizations
What is a model focused on?
Specific aspects of reality and degrades or ignores the rest
